Hockey World Cup: New Zealand play 2-2 draw against Spain
Bhubaneswar
06-December-2018
New Zealand registered a came from behind 2-2 draw against Spain in Pool A match of the Hockey World Cup here on Thursday.
Spain's Albert Beltran (ninth minute) and Alvaro Iglesias (27th minute) scored in the first half to put their team ahead.
But New Zealand's Hayden Phillips (50th minute) and Kane Russell's (56th minute) strike helped their team register a thrilling draw. - IANS
